Saturday, April 12, 2008

Here is another reason why it is almost impossible to hold China accountable for it's record on human rights.

1 comment:

  1. we are boycotting China- as much as we can....

    ( some stuff you just don't know Where it came from)


Don't feed the trolls!
It just goes directly to their thighs.